Corrosion Resistant Resin Market was valued at USD 8,992.55 million in the year 2024. The size of this market is expected to increase to USD 12,994.73 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 5.4%.

Corrosion Resistant Resin Market, Segmentation by Type
The Corrosion Resistant Resin Market has been Segmented By Type into Epoxy, Polyester, Polyurethane, Vinyl Ester and Others.
Epoxy
Epoxy resins hold nearly 28% share in the market due to their exceptional mechanical strength, strong adhesion properties, and superior chemical resistance. They are widely applied in marine, oil & gas, and industrial coatings, making them a preferred option for long-term corrosion protection.
Polyester
Polyester resins account for around 22%, driven by their cost-effectiveness and good resistance to moisture. They are often used in construction materials, tanks, and pipes, offering reliable durability where moderate corrosion resistance is required at affordable costs.
Polyurethane
Polyurethane represents approximately 18% of the market, valued for its flexibility and excellent abrasion resistance. Its widespread use in protective coatings, automotive components, and infrastructure projects highlights its ability to withstand mechanical stress and corrosive environments.
Vinyl Ester
Vinyl ester resins capture nearly 20% of the share owing to their high chemical resistance and strong thermal stability. They are extensively used in oil & gas, marine, and chemical industries for equipment requiring long service life under extreme conditions.
Others
Other resin types make up close to 12%, including specialized formulations designed for niche industrial applications. These resins provide tailored solutions in custom coatings, composites, and special environments where unique performance requirements are critical for corrosion prevention.
Corrosion Resistant Resin Market, Segmentation by Application
The Corrosion Resistant Resin Market has been Segmented By Application into Coatings, Composites and Others.
Coatings
Coatings dominate the market with nearly 45% share, driven by their role in providing protective barriers against harsh environments. They are extensively used in marine, oil & gas, and construction sectors, offering long-lasting durability and effective corrosion resistance.
Composites
Composites account for around 35%, as they combine lightweight properties with superior mechanical strength. Widely adopted in aerospace, automotive, and industrial equipment, they deliver enhanced corrosion protection while improving efficiency and performance under demanding conditions.
Others
The remaining 20% comes from applications in specialized industries such as electronics, energy, and custom manufacturing. These segments rely on corrosion-resistant resins for tailored solutions that meet unique requirements of performance, safety, and long-term durability.
Corrosion Resistant Resin Market, Segmentation by End User
The Corrosion Resistant Resin Market has been Segmented By End User into Marine, Automotive & transportation, Oil & gas, Infrastructure, Heavy industries and Others.
Marine
The marine sector contributes nearly 30% of demand, relying on corrosion resistant resins to protect vessels, offshore structures, and pipelines. Their ability to withstand saltwater exposure and extreme environmental conditions makes them vital for extending service life and reducing maintenance costs.
Automotive & Transportation
Automotive & transportation applications hold around 25%, where resins are used in lightweight components, fuel systems, and coatings. They improve durability, extend vehicle lifespan, and ensure resistance against chemicals, fuels, and environmental wear.
Oil & Gas
The oil & gas industry accounts for nearly 20%, driven by the need for pipeline coatings, storage tanks, and drilling equipment. Corrosion resistant resins enhance operational reliability and reduce risks of equipment failure under aggressive conditions.
Infrastructure
Infrastructure uses approximately 15%, with applications in bridges, tunnels, and water treatment plants. These resins strengthen structural durability while offering long-term protection against environmental degradation and chemical exposure.
Heavy Industries
Heavy industries hold close to 7%, deploying resins in manufacturing equipment, processing plants, and industrial machinery. They ensure efficiency, safety, and reduced downtime by combating chemical and thermal corrosion in high-intensity environments.
Others
The remaining 3% is spread across specialized sectors such as electronics, energy, and niche manufacturing. These industries leverage corrosion resistant resins for customized solutions tailored to their unique operational needs.
